🧭 What Is a Virtual CTO?
A Virtual CTO (Chief Technology Officer) is a part-time or remote technology executive who provides strategic leadership, tech oversight, and innovation guidance—without the overhead of a full-time C-level hire.
They bring years of technical experience, business acumen, and product insight—making them a perfect fit for startups, SMEs, and even larger enterprises in transition.

🤝 How Virtual CTOs Help Align Product and Business Goals
A Virtual CTO offers much more than tech guidance—they bring strategic synchronization between your business needs and the technology roadmap. Here's how:
1. Strategic Product Roadmapping
Virtual CTOs translate business goals into technical milestones. Instead of blindly building features, they:
- Define clear product development stages
- Prioritize features that align with ROI goals
- Cut unnecessary build-outs that don’t serve business value

2. Market and Tech Trend Analysis
A good Virtual CTO keeps a pulse on emerging technologies and industry trends, ensuring your product stays competitive. They guide you on:
- Choosing the right tech stack for scalability
- Timing tech rollouts based on market readiness
- Building flexible architectures for rapid iteration
This ensures your product doesn't just "exist"—it thrives in the current market landscape.
3. Cross-Department Communication
Virtual CTOs serve as a translator between the business, marketing, design, and development teams. They eliminate silos by:
- Clarifying technical constraints to non-technical stakeholders
- Aligning technical timelines with marketing campaigns
- Ensuring UX decisions align with business KPIs
🧩 Alignment means everyone is working toward the same goal—not just building for the sake of building.
4. Cost-Efficient Technical Oversight
By identifying scalable solutions and avoiding over-engineering, Virtual CTOs reduce tech debt and optimize your development budget.
- They vet vendors and tools
- Recommend lean MVP strategies
- Audit code and infrastructure for long-term sustainability
